Abstract/Summary

Report on a ground penetrating radar (GPR) survey carried out in November 2012 by Historic England’s remote sensing team to assist in the investigation of water ingress through external walls into the Captain’s Chamber. Survey was done over the face of the external walls from a two-tier scaffolding platform, and results confirmed sufficient penetration to provide useful information. Anomalies were recorded that related to the varying thickness of the outer wall and the location of known defects such as timber sockets visible from inside. Further defects in the structural integrity of the wall were suggested including an area below the string corbel and areas where there were corroded ferrous fixings.
